Sue Cardamone was a beloved teacher at Berlin Community School, Laurel Springs Elementary and Samuel S. Yellin Middle School. When she was battling adrenal cancer her friends, family and colleagues came together to help with the costs associated with treatment. Sadly, Sue was not able to survive the cancer. The Berlin Community School Teachers, with help from the Cardamone family, have continued the fundraising 5K in Sue’s memory for the past 5 years. The 6th annual Sue Cardamone took place May 19th in the “Berlin Woods” development. As a result of the donations and race proceeds, scholarships are able to be awarded to students upon graduation from Eastern Regional High School and from Berlin Community School. Over 500 runners participate each year in the Sue Cardamone Scholarship Run and $16,000 in scholarship money has been raised and disbursed.
